首页 > 试题广场 >

SQL语句执行的顺序是

[单选题]
SQL语句执行的顺序是
  • 1.SELECT<br>2.JOIN ON<br>3.FROM<br>4.WHERE<br>5.GROUP BY<br>6.HAVING<br>7.ORDER BY
  • 1.SELECT<br>2.FROM<br>3.JOIN ON<br>4.WHERE<br>5.GROUP BY<br>6.HAVING<br>7.ORDER BY
  • 1.FROM<br>2.JOIN ON<br>3.WHERE<br>4.GROUP BY<br>5.HAVING<br>6.SELECT<br>7.ORDER BY
  • 1.JOIN ON<br>2.WHERE<br>3.GROUP BY<br>4.HAVING<br>5.SELECT<br>6.FROM<br>7.ORDER BY
mysql的执行顺序是 from join on  where groupby having select  order by
发表于 2018-11-15 11:02:33 回复(0)
别的数据库不清楚,Oracle应该是先where再join。这题太绝的了吧
发表于 2020-09-09 21:49:20 回复(0)